J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Own PCB designs for power supply modules and mixed-signal cards from beginning to end, including conducting design reviews for component placement, routing, and fabrication file reviews for DFM, DFC, and DFT.
- Perform complex digital, analog and power electronics PCB design in Altium Designer, working closely with power electronics, manufacturing, and mechanical design engineers.
- Generate mechanical 3D models and work with mechanical engineers to ensure compliance with mechanical and environmental requirements.
- Generate and release Assembly Drawings, Fabrication Drawings, and PCB fabrication files (Gerbers, ODB++).
- Review schematic symbols and generate IPC compliant PCB component footprints.
- Participate in full product lifecycle development from board design to release into manufacturing and production support.
JOB REQUIREMENTS AND M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
- Associate’s degree in Electronics Engineering Technology or similar.
- +7 years of experience as a PCB Designer.
- Strong experience with Altium Designer.
- Strong experience with PCB design with a focus on digital and power electronics. This includes understanding of critical component placement and routing for analog and power electronics circuits that include power converters, gate driver, EMI filter, analog and digital controllers.
- Experience with shielding and PCB design to mitigate EMI and crosstalk.
- Knowledge of current density requirements for high current circuits, including strong understanding of via selection and power/ground plane design to meet signal integrity, power integrity, and thermal management.
- Experience with high-reliability, aerospace, and/or IPC Class 3 designs.
- Strong experience with design for manufacturability (DFM), design for cost (DFC), and design for testability (DFT).
- Strong organizational skills.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
